Impacts of Rain on Installment



When it rains, roof installment can encounter significant obstacles. Wet conditions can make surfaces slippery, enhancing the risk of accidents for you and your staff. It's vital to focus on safety throughout these times; otherwise, you could locate the job ending up being extra hazardous than effective.

Additionally, rain can influence the materials you're making use of. If roof shingles or other roof materials splash, they can be harmed, resulting in potential leaks and minimized lifespan. You'll want to guarantee everything stays dry to maintain top quality and stay clear of pricey replacements later on.

Furthermore, rain can delay your job timeline. If you're not able to work because of harsh weather condition, you may find yourself pushing back completion dates. This can interfere with not only your timetable yet likewise your customers' plans.

To minimize these issues, think about preparing your setup throughout drier seasons or keeping an eye on weather forecasts. If rain is expected, you may want to hold off the installation to make sure a safe and effective process.

Eventually, understanding just how rainfall affects your roofing job can help you make educated choices and maintain your workflow smooth.

Challenges of Extreme Temperatures



Severe temperature levels can present substantial difficulties for roof covering installment. If you're operating in severe heat, products like asphalt shingles can end up being excessively pliable, making them challenging to place precisely. You may find that the adhesive utilized for roof products doesn't bond correctly, bring about potential concerns down the line.

On the other hand, when temperatures drop, products can become weak. This brittleness can create shingles to split or break throughout installment, compromising the integrity of your roof covering.

Additionally, extreme cold can reduce the curing process of adhesives and sealants, making it harder for them to set correctly. You might need to wait longer before using added layers or completing the task.

To mitigate these difficulties, you must intend your setup timing carefully. Early morning or late afternoon can be ideal throughout warm days, while selecting milder days is vital in the winter months.
